当前位置: 首页 > news >正文

【选择开源商城系统的风险】

选择开源商城系统确实能节省初期成本,但清晰认识其中的风险至关重要。下面这个表格汇总了核心风险点,方便你快速把握。
风险类别
具体风险点
潜在影响
🛡️ 安全与稳定​
代码公开,漏洞易被黑客发现和利用
数据泄露、服务中断、经济损失
依赖社区维护,可能面临项目“断更”
安全漏洞无人修复,系统无法适应新发展
内置或依赖的第三方组件可能存在安全隐患
引入未知后门,造成连锁安全风险
⚖️ 法律与合规​
开源协议(如GPL)可能要求衍生项目也必须开源
被迫公开自有商业源码,或面临法律纠纷
部分授权可能限制域名、IP数量或禁止去除版权信息
商业运营灵活度受限,存在侵权风险
代码中可能包含未授权的第三方知识产权内容
高额赔偿、产品下架
🔧 技术与管理​
需自建技术团队进行部署、定制、运维和二次开发
实际总成本(TCO)可能远超预期
缺乏官方专业技术支持,依赖社区论坛
问题排查效率低,可能影响业务正常运营
确保多平台(如PC、小程序)一致体验技术复杂
开发难度和成本增加,用户体验不佳
💡 如何有效规避风险
认识到风险后,采取系统性的措施进行规避是关键。
第一步:做好法律合规性审查
仔细阅读协议:在选用任何开源系统前,务必仔细阅读其开源协议(License)。明确协议是宽松的MIT、Apache 2.0,还是具有“传染性”的GPL。确保你的使用方式(特别是商用和二次开发)符合协议要求 。
检查授权细节:确认授权是否允许你去除原系统版权信息,以及是否对部署的域名或服务器数量有限制 。
咨询专业人士:如果对协议条款的理解存在疑虑,尤其是在复杂的商业应用场景下,建议咨询知识产权律师。
第二步:进行严格的技术安全评估
选择活跃项目:优先选择GitHub/Gitee上星标多、更新频繁、Issue响应及时的项目。一个活跃的社区是项目生命力的保障 。
代码安全审计:即使不是安全专家,也可以利用一些自动化工具(如SonarQube)对代码进行基础扫描,检查是否有明显的安全漏洞或代码质量问题 。
关注安全实践:检查项目文档或代码,看是否实施了关键安全措施,如用户密码加密存储(BCrypt)、防止SQL注入和XSS攻击、管理后台权限控制(RBAC模型)等 。
第三步:规划长期的运维与投入
评估团队能力:诚实地评估你的技术团队是否有能力胜任后续的维护、升级和定制开发工作。如果答案是否定的,应提前规划寻求外部技术支持的渠道和预算 。
制定更新策略:建立机制,持续关注所选开源项目的官方更新,特别是安全补丁,并及时应用到你的系统中 。
考虑商业替代方案:如果业务对安全性、稳定性和支持服务要求极高,预算允许的情况下,直接采购成熟的商业产品(SaaS或本地部署)或进行定制开发,可能是更稳妥和经济的选择 。
💎 总结
开源商城系统是一把双刃剑,它在提供低成本、高灵活性的同时,也带来了在安全、法律、技术维护等方面的显著挑战。成功的核心在于充分的尽职调查(法律合规与安全评估)和持续的投入准备(技术团队与运维规划)。
希望这些分析能帮助你做出更明智的决策。如果你对特定类型的开源协议或者某个具体开源项目的风险评估有更深入的疑问,我很乐意继续提供我的看法。

http://www.jsqmd.com/news/356115/

相关文章:

  • 知识库投喂:如何构建与优化AI的核心大脑
  • blazor中 @bind 和 @bind-value 有什么区别
  • python并行编程:使用 joblib / threadpoolctl 实现后端线程数可控的并行化科学计算编程 —— 实现不同线程池下的numpy矩阵计算
  • 量子计算与人工智能:未来科技的双重引擎,如何推动便捷的技术革新
  • P3131 [USACO16JAN] Subsequences Summing to Sevens S
  • Day30鼠标经过事件的区别
  • 什么是GPON和融合网关?
  • 扩散模型如何重塑时间序列分析?一文读懂最新综述
  • LDO 500mA 带载温升测试
  • AI编程工具全景图:从代码补全到智能体协作
  • 《电源测试不求人!纹波 / 效率 / 过流保护等 11 项测试规范(附记录表格)》
  • ue 角色驱动衣服 绑定衣服
  • 电源选型封神帖:宽压 / 高压差 / 低噪声场景的 LDO 与 DCDC 抉择
  • 通达信端口问题
  • 第九章-数字三角形
  • AtCoder Beginner Contest 444 ABCDE 题目解析
  • Electron 应用中的系统检测方案对比 - 教程
  • 《Ionic Range:深度解析与使用指南》
  • Python3 SMTP发送邮件教程
  • 数字图像处理篇---图像锐化
  • 数字图像处理篇---图像模糊
  • 基于SpringBoot的网购平台管理系统毕业设计源码
  • jQuery 隐藏/显示
  • 深度解析 Elasticsearch:从倒排索引到 DSL 查询的实战突围
  • C 标准库 - `<float.h>`
  • HiBit Startup Manager(启动项优化工具)
  • AI写论文测评来啦!4款AI论文生成工具,优劣一目了然!
  • SnailJob发布任务类型详解
  • Listary Portable
  • AI写论文别发愁,4款AI论文写作神器 让毕业论文撰写不再是难事!